I recently made a change to the landing page of a website so that it=20
shows a short flash video (chosen randomly). Previously we had used=20
quicktime but the speed was too slow for some machines. I converted the=20
files to SWF using Flash Video Studio 2.0.

Someone using IE7 has now reported really peculiar behaviour. The video=20
plays. She then logs in as a member and leaves that page and then goes=20
to one of the articles pages (so two steps now from the original landing =

page) and then suddenly it returns to the landing page showing a video=20
again.

(In the normal navigation scheme it is not even possible for logged in=20
members to navigate back to that page unless they log out but she says=20
she remains logged in.)

I believe there are some known problems with IE7 and flash but am not=20
very experienced with flash and so do not know if this would be the=20
cause. Has anyone any notion of what might be going on?
